#top .search_area .search #searchbutton {
	background-image:url(/uploads/image/ptcdepa1388456635690148/search_btn.gif);
	background-position:-58px 0;
	background-repeat:no-repeat;
	border:medium none;
	float:left;
	height:19px;
	line-height:0;
	width:29px;
}
#top #top_menu li {
	height:38px;
	padding-right:14px;
	padding-left:6px;
	list-style:none;
	float:left;
	border-left:1px solid #999999;
	background:;
}
#top #logo {
	float:left;
	width:315px;
	padding-top:30px;
	padding-left:25px;
}
#top .search_area .search input {
	height:19px;
	vertical-align:top;
}
#top .search_area .search #searchbutton:hover {
	background-position:-58px -19px;
}
#top #top_menu {
	float:right;
	height:42px;
	width:555px;
	margin-top:14px;
}
#top {
	height:104px;
	width:930px;
	list-style:none;
	margin-right:auto;
	margin-left:auto;
	background-color:#ffffff;
	border-right-width:1px;
	border-left-width:1px;
	border-right-style:solid;
	border-left-style:solid;
	border-right-color:#cccccc;
	border-left-color:#cccccc;
}
#top .search_area .search input.text {
	background:url(/uploads/image/ptcdepa1388456635690148/search.jpg) repeat-x scroll 0 0 rgba(0, 0, 0, 0);
	border:medium none;
	float:left;
	padding:0 3px 0 0;
}
#top #top_menu ul {
	margin:0px;
	padding:0px;
}
#top .search_area {
	float:right;
	margin:10px 25px 0 0;
}
#top .search_area .search {
	background:url(/uploads/image/ptcdepa1388456635690148/search_left.png) no-repeat scroll 0 0 rgba(0, 0, 0, 0);
	height:19px;
	padding-left:9px;
	position:relative;
}